Module: (Python) ワークショップ - 6: 「フォースと共にありますように!」


Problem

5 /6


筋力増加

Problem

「フォースがあなたと共にありますように」 —スター・ウォーズの世界に興味のない人でも聞いたことがある有名なフレーズです。 
個人がフォースを直接制御する能力は、体内のミディクロリアンのレベルに依存します。

Nジェダイのそれぞれの強さを教えてください: A1,...,AN.
力の最大値と最小値をそれぞれ max(A)min(A) とします。
すべてのジェダイ SS=A1+A2+…+AN の合計強度を計算します。
 各ジェダイの力を違い S とこの要素に置き換えてみましょう: Ai:=S-Ai, \( 1<=i<=N\).
この変換を力の増加と呼びます。

配列 Bを指定すると、 結果が K–乗じて、ジェダイの強さのリストに強さをインクリメントし、 差を計算するプログラムを作成します。最大(A)-最小(A).

入力
最初の行には、整数  N  と  K が含まれています。ここで  N —配列要素の数 B (\(2 <= N <= 10000\)), a < code >K — nbsp;nbsp;回数 力をインクリメント 初期配列に A\ (1 <= K <= 100\)
2 行目には N 配列要素 B. 配列要素 B — が含まれます。  -2 000 000 000 から 2 000 000 000 の範囲に属する整数。

出力 
出力ファイルの唯一の行には、 max(A) と  min(A) の差である整数が含まれている必要があります。
 
<頭> <本体>
# 入力 出力
1 4 2
45 52 47 46
7